Number of Servings: 10

Ingredients

    1 pkg (12 oz) San Giorgio Jumo Shells, uncooked
    4 c. park skim ricotta cheese
    2 c. shredded part skim mozzarella cheese
    0.75 c. grated Parmesan cheese
    2 eggs
    1 T. chopped fresh parsley
    0.75 tsp. dried oregano leaves
    0.5 tsp. salt
    0.25 tsp. ground black pepper
    3 c. (about 26-oz jar) spaghetti sauce

Directions

Heat oven to 350°F.
2. Cook shells: Add 1 T. salt to 5 qt. water and bring to a rapid boil. Add full box of shells and stir; return to rapid boil. Cook uncovered for 10 mins, stirring occastionally. Drain well. Separated cooked shells and lay on wax paper or aluminum foil to keep from sticking.
3. Combine cheeses, eggs, parsley, oregano, salt, and pepper. In 13x9x2" baking dish, apread 1/2 c. sauce. Fill each cooked shell with about 2 T. cheese mixture. Layer one-half of filled shells in prepared baking dish; spread one-half remaining suace over shells. Layer remaining filled shells over sauce; spread remaining sauce over shells. Sprinkle with additional Parmesan cheese, if desired.
4. Cover with foil. Bake 35 mins or until hot and bubbly.

Makes 10 servings of 4 shells.
